ROHM Semiconductor GmbH 200mA 3.3V Output, Ultra Low Iq, High-Accuracy LDO Regulator for Automotive BD733U2EFJ-C

Description
The BD733U2EFJ-C is low quiescent regulators featuring 50V absolute maximum voltage, and output voltage accuracy of ±2%, 200mA output current and 6μA (Typ) current consumption. These regulators are therefore ideal for applications requiring a direct connection to the battery and a low current consumption. Ceramic capacitors can be used for compensation of the output capacitor phase. This IC uses different production line against series model BD733L2EFJ-C for the purpose of improving production efficiency. We recommend using this IC for your new development. Electric characteristics noted in Datasheet does not differ between Production Line.
